  • I’m a legal immigrant (to the USA), there absolutely should be a legal path to emigrate to any and all countries.

    The only difference between me and her is that I could afford not to work for the 7 months between landing in the country and my green card arriving in the mail, as well as the roughly $10k in fees, and I don’t have kids so being apart from my (then fiancee, now) wife for 14 months while the paperwork went through was also not such a big burden.

    Having the privilege to endure those hardships does not constitute the entirety of being a good citizen.
